Kuntoor Population - Nanded, Maharashtra

Kuntoor is a large village located in Naigaon (Khairgaon) Taluka of Nanded district, Maharashtra with total 1278 families residing. The Kuntoor village has population of 5981 of which 3130 are males while 2851 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kuntoor village population of children with age 0-6 is 793 which makes up 13.26 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kuntoor village is 911 which is lower than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Kuntoor as per census is 870, lower than Maharashtra average of 894.

Kuntoor village has lower liter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Kuntoor village was 70.10 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Kuntoor Male literacy stands at 79.27 % while female literacy rate was 60.11 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 18.41 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 4.26 % of total population in Kuntoor village.

Work Profile

In Kuntoor village out of total population, 3309 were engaged in work activities. 88.12 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 11.88 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 3309 workers engaged in Main Work, 620 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 1881 were Agricultural labourer.
